Melissa Linebaugh graduated cum laude from the University of Baltimore in 2008. While in law school, Attorney Linebaugh was an Honors Contract Law Scholar and a published member of the Law Review. Attorney Linebaugh clerked for the Honorable John Phillip Miller of the Baltimore City Circuit Court after law school.
After clerking, Attorney Linebaugh practiced Social Security Disability law, successfully representing clients in hearings throughout Maryland and Washington, D.C. She then went into private practice, where she specialized in serving low-income clients in domestic matters such as custody, divorce, criminal law, and estate planning.
